No traffic road cycling routes around Astigarraga navigate a diverse landscape characterized by hilly terrain, extensive apple orchards, and scenic river valleys. The region, located in the Basque Country, offers varied gradients from moderate riverside paths along the Urumea River to more demanding climbs in areas such as Jaizkibel. This provides a range of experiences for road cyclists seeking quiet routes.

There are 10 dedicated no-traffic road cycling routes around Astigarraga, offering a variety of experiences for road cyclists. These routes are designed to keep you away from heavy vehicle traffic, allowing for a more peaceful ride.
Yes, Astigarraga offers several easy no-traffic road cycling routes perfect for beginners or families. For instance, the Urumea River (Ugaldetxo) – Fagollaga Spring loop from Estacion Hernani is an excellent choice, providing a gentle ride along the scenic Urumea River. Another accessible option is the Vía Verde de Arditurri – Arditurri Mining Complex loop from Fanderia, which follows a former railway line.
The region around Astigarraga features diverse terrain. While some routes offer moderate climbs through hilly landscapes and apple orchards, others follow more gentle paths along river valleys. You'll find a mix of rolling hills and flatter sections, ensuring varied cycling experiences.
Yes, for experienced riders seeking a challenge, routes like the Urumea River (Ugaldetxo) – Goizueta Fountain loop from Martutene offer significant elevation gain and longer distances. Another demanding option is the Jaizkibel – Jaizkibel Climb from Pasaia loop from Lezo -Errenteria, which includes the iconic Jaizkibel climb with rewarding coastal views.
The spring and autumn months are generally ideal for road cycling in Astigarraga, offering pleasant temperatures and vibrant landscapes, especially when the apple orchards are in bloom or laden with fruit. Summer can also be enjoyable, though it's advisable to ride earlier in the morning or later in the afternoon to avoid the midday heat. Winter rides are possible, but check local weather conditions for rain or cooler temperatures.
The no-traffic road cycling routes around Astigarraga are highly regarded by the komoot community, with an average rating of 4.35 out of 5 stars from over 260 reviews. Cyclists often praise the scenic beauty, the quiet roads, and the variety of routes available, from riverside paths to challenging climbs.
Many of the no-traffic road cycling routes in Astigarraga are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. Examples include the Urumea River (Ugaldetxo) – Goizueta Fountain loop from Martutene and the Jaizkibel – Jaizkibel Climb from Pasaia loop from Lezo -Errenteria, providing convenient options for your ride.
The routes offer numerous scenic spots. You might encounter panoramic views from the Jaizkibel Summit, or enjoy the picturesque Urumea River valley. The region is also known for its apple orchards, which are particularly beautiful during bloom and harvest seasons. The View from Monte Urgull is also accessible from some routes, offering stunning vistas of San Sebastián.
Yes, the region includes sections of Greenways that are ideal for car-free cycling. The Vía Verde de Arditurri – Arditurri Mining Complex loop from Fanderia is a notable example, utilizing a former railway line that has been converted into a scenic path, perfect for a relaxed ride away from traffic.
Many routes start from towns or villages like Martutene, Estacion Hernani, or Fanderia, which typically offer public parking facilities. For specific routes, it's advisable to check the route details on komoot, as they often include information about suitable starting points and parking options.
Yes, many routes pass through or near small towns and villages where you can find cafes, bars, and restaurants. Given Astigarraga's reputation as the 'Cider Capital,' you'll also find traditional cider houses (sagardotegiak) along some paths, offering a unique cultural experience and local refreshments.
Beyond the natural beauty, you can explore cultural sites such as the Sagardoetxea (Cider House Museum) in Astigarraga, which delves into the region's cider-making heritage. The Santiagomendi Mountain features a chapel dedicated to St. James and an ethnographic park. The historic Ergobia Bridge, an 18th-century stone bridge over the Urumea River, is also a notable landmark.
